E6000

EE-siks-THOW-zund · noun · informal

A strong, flexible glue favored for cosplay assembly.

People Also Ask

What is E6000?

A clear, industrial-strength flexible adhesive widely used in cosplay to bond rhinestones, foam, and mixed materials in builds and repairs.

Why do cosplayers use E6000?

It's strong yet flexible and bonds many different materials, making it reliable for gems, foam, and general assembly.

How long does E6000 take to cure?

It sets in a matter of minutes but is best left to cure fully overnight for a strong, lasting bond.
